The Tulum Archeological Zone is a highlight of this tour, offering a glimpse into the region’s historical significance. Travelers have the option to spend up to 4 hours exploring ruins and learning about Mayan culture, all while avoiding the crowds typical of larger tour groups.
The site features well-preserved structures perched above the Caribbean Sea, providing stunning views and photo opportunities. The private nature of this trip allows for ample time to wander and appreciate the archaeological site at your own pace.

One of the key attractions included is a visit to one of the many cenotes in the area. These natural freshwater sinkholes are perfect for a quick swim or photo stop.
